Explore your future career 🔭:

Integrated into the GAM team, your role will be to support the coordination and collaboration of our multi-country operations..

As part of this role, you will help deploy cross-functional action plans with GAM leadership and senior Sales teams to improve internal processes and strengthen scaling capabilities.

You will also support high-stakes client meetings by gathering key insights, analyzing industry trends, and defining clear objectives and messages to drive successful outcomes.

Being an intern in this position means actively contributing to international teamwork while developing your autonomy and gaining a comprehensive understanding of operational strategy, sales support, and project execution.

Key responsibilities ✨:

International Orchestration & Collaboration
  • Facilitate the coordination of our multi-country team in support of the GAM MD and local Heads Of, by collecting / documenting / sharing of best practices across countries.
  • Optimize operational routines to streamline international exchanges and ensure effective coordination across markets.
    Operational Strategy & Scaling
    • Deploy cross-functional action plans in collaboration with GAM leadership and senior Sales team members to improve internal processes and strengthen scaling capabilities.
      Sales Support & Operational Excellence
      • Prepare high-stakes client meetings by gathering key insights (project feasibility, industry trends, key challenges) and defining the main objectives and messages to be delivered.


        About you 🧑‍🚀

        • Currently enrolled in business school or similar and looking for a full-time 6 month internship starting in July 2026.
        • Ideally with previous experience in a B2B sales context.
        • Excellent interpersonal skills, including strong communication, proactivity, and adaptability.
        • A fluent level of English is important to be able to communicate with an international team
        • A native level of French 


          How to join the mission? 🚀

          • First call in French with a member of the Talent Acquisition team to better understand your background, aspirations and answer your questions (30 minutes).
          • Interview with members of the Sales team to discuss your experience and the role in more detail (45-60 minutes).
          • Last Interview with the Head of Sales of your department.
          • Your profile is validated, and will welcome you in our Parisian office in July 2026!
